Start Packing Before Finals

If you put off packing until finals week, you won’t be able to give your full attention to what’s most important — your upcoming exams. Start filling boxes weeks in advance. If you live close to home, load up your car and make a few trips before finals week. Get Quotes From Reputable Moving Companies

Moving companies look kindly upon customers who reserve moving trucks far in advance of moving day. If you want the best rates, start shopping early on and lock in good deals before they’re gone.
